The Government of Indonesia embarked on a comprehensive program of public financial management modernization and reform in the wake of the 1997 economic crisis. One of the key areas of focus is tax administration, where inefficiencies and poor governance in the Directorate General of Taxation (DGT) are widely perceived to impede revenue generation and to adversely impact the investment climate. Considerable efforts have therefore been made to accelerate the modernization of tax administration. This has included the rollout of modernized offices, the restructuring of the Head Office and extensive individual reform efforts aimed at improving service capability, governance and revenue generation.
AusAID has supported these modernization efforts since 2004 through TAMF III and the DGT Tax Sub-Facility. Initially with an emphasis on high-level strategic planning assistance to underpin DGT’s Modernization program – including development of strategic and operational plans, assistance in the establishment of Transformation Unit responsible for internal direction on reform matters. From 2007 TAMF III directed support to tax revenue generation and governance. Assistance in 2009 saw a focus on activities that facilitated the measurement of performance and improvements in governance; the most notable being the outbound Call Centre.
In mid 2009 DGT initiated a new Modernization Program, which focused on the automation and enabling of processes, as well as people development. AIPEG is presently providing support in the areas of internal investigations, surveys on small tax payer offices, database analysis and legal prosecution (objection and appeals), all of which directly support the new modernization objectives.
AIPEG is also supporting DGT with capacity development in IT and HR as a precursor to the World Bank funded PINTAR Tax Program. In developing the AIPEG 2010/2011 program of activities, AIPEG has focused on the Strategic Plan of DGT 2008-2012 and identified areas that would serve both the DGT and AIPEG objectives. Thus AIPEG will assist with:
- Improved Taxpayer service through a new fresh approach to Communication and specifically Governance
- Tax Payer Compliance
- Human Resource development with a focus on HR Strategies and plans as well as legal capacity building
